This research discusses bureaucracy and organizational behaviour and culture in Islamic education institute i.e., Roudlotul Athfal UIN Sunan Kalijaga Yogyakarta. This research aims to study the implementation of institutional bureaucracy and to build organisational behaviour and culture. This is a qualitative research applying three methods of data collection, namely: (1) observation, (2) in-depth interview, (3) emphasizing the value of dialogue ​​(small colloquium, discussion or sharing), (2) Integrating Islamic values ​​to build organizational behaviour such as honesty, discipline and mutual respect. (3) Cultural acculturation as part of the organizational cultural identity, such as maintaining the grassroots culture including how to behave, how to communicate in certain language and other social interactions. These aspects ​​turn into the basic values of institutional bureaucracy in facing various challenges, social changes as well as competition among numerous Islamic educational institutions.

Historically, Islamic boarding schools were Islamic educational institutions developed by Indonesian people. Because actually pesantren is a cultural product of Indonesian people who are fully aware of the importance of education for indigenous people who grow naturally. Regardless of where the tradition and system is adopted, it will not affect unique patterns and have taken root and lived in the community. The pattern of life in pesantren is formed naturally through the process of planting values and developing the process of influencing influence with society. Islamic boarding schools always experience dynamics that never stop, in line with the social changes that occur.In the pesantren management system, the existence of a vision and mission occupies an important position. The vision must be formulated earlier and then set forth in the mission, namely programs and activities to realize the vision, and furthermore is to compile an action program in a mature and flexible plan to be implemented in a certain period of time in stages. The vision and mission of Islamic education which is the hope, ideals, and goals of Islamic education, are basically built from Islamic values and the results of analysis of the existence of Islamic education.Islamic boarding schools should be the center of Islamic education development, because; Islamic Boarding School is a center of religious education, which combines general and religious education, becomes a fortress for scientific balancers which are increasingly rapid by the influence of globalization, the development of science and knowledge is unstoppable, so Islamic boarding schools present as a fortress to provide boundaries that are in accordance with Islamization. This paper explains how Islamic boarding schools should be in developing Islamic education, preserving and preserving Islamic scholarship as a practice and practice.

Ali Bin Abi Talib once said that children should be educated in accordance with the  development of the times. The Ali bin Abi Talib’s statement could be considered as his attention more to the development of human civilization. For that reason, there should be studies focused on the role of educational institutions in facing the challenges of the times. On this stand, the writer raises the existence of pesantren (Islamic boarding schools) for being considered to have been able to survive amid the onslaught of civilization increasingly obscuring cultural identity. In addition, this study also aims to identify and discuss the role of pesantren in the modern era. This is a literature study using a descriptive and exploratory approach. It can be concluded that pesantren are non-formal Islamic educational institutions. Pesantren have permanent and distictive methods and learning models. The purpose of pesantren education is the same as Islamic education in general, instilling a sense of virtue, familiarizing themselves with courtesy, preparing for a holy, sincere and honest life entirely. Pesantren could be seen from three aspects: (a) pesantren that are seen from facilities and infrastructures, (b) pesantren that are seen from disciplines taught, and (c) pesantren that are seen from the fields of knowledge.

There have been a lot of studies on the history and development of Islamic education in Indonesia conducted by various groups. At least, there are three important aspects that should be noted in this study. First, from the aspect of the region, the history of Islamic education in South Sumatera which has never been comprehensively studied since the colonial era. Second, related to theoretical assumption, the question of whether the development of the system and the modern Islamic institution in Palembang during colonial era tend to be dominated by Muslim reformers or Muslim traditionalists. Third, from the point of view of methodology which tends to be descriptive and chronological, though recently there arises an analytical approach in which the system and the institution are not seen as things that can stand on their own, but are attached to social, religious, cultural, and political aspects. It is this approach which will be used in this study. Therefore, this study will try to look into the relationship between various social changes in Palembang and the system and Islamic educational institutions in the colonial era.

Abstract: Modern Islamic boarding schools are also called  pesantren kholaf (modern)  as acronyms of salaf or ashriyah. The model of integration of Islam, science and culture is contained in the conditions of the Islamic boarding school, the methods, traditions and intellectual spirit of the santri in the pesantren Khalaf  with all the combination of Islamic values ​​and culture, having challenges that must be overcome in facing challenges in the global era. With its very integrated the slogan, al muhafadhah 'ala al qadim al shalih wa al-ahdz bi al-jadid allashlah (holding good old things and taking new things better. This slogan can be the key to reconciling tradition and modernization: Modernization in Islamic education is a renewal that occurs in Islamic boarding schools, at least it can erase the image of some people who consider Islamic boarding schools to be traditional educational institutions, now they want to produce true scientists who are able to produce ulama. protect the people and advance the nation and state. Management of  Islamic education institutions can be defined  as a form of cooperation to carry out planning functions, organizing, preparation of personnel or staffing, direction and leadership, and supervision of the efforts of members  of  Islamic  education  institutions  and  the  use  of  human,  financial, physical and other resources by making Islam the foundation and guide in their operational practices to achieve the objectives of Islamic education institutions in various types and forms which essentially try to help someone or a group of students in instilling teachings and / or develop Islamic values. This study wanted to find out the management and defense owned by Islamic education institutions in  managing  Islamic  education  institutions.  This  study aims  to  determine the management and challenges of Islamic education institutions in the tahfiẓ al- Qur'an program in Ma’had Umar Bin Al-Khattab, Muhammadiyah University of Surabaya. This type of research is qualitative research, namely research that produces descriptive data, namely a type of research that seeks to present data and actual facts about the management of Islamic education institutions in the tahfiẓ al-Qur'an program in Ma'had Umar Bin Al-Khattab University Muhammadiyah Surabaya. Data collection techniques used in this study were (1) interview (2) observation (3) documentation. For data analysis using descriptive techniques, the application is carried out in three activities, namely data reduction, data presentation, and conclusion or verification. The results of this study indicate that first, planning in Ma'had Tahfiẓ Umar Bin Al-Khattab Surabaya carried out activities (1) developing a strategic plan, which included vision and mission, objectives, strategic programs, implementation strategies, monitoring and evaluation; (2) arranging the rules of the santri (3) compiling technical guidelines for the implementation of activities. Second, organizing in managing Ma'had Tahfiẓ Umar Bin Al-Khattab, including (1) arranging the organizational structure and the map of the program's responsibility (2) preparing the tasks and positions of each personnel (3) structuring the program. Third, the mobilization in Ma'had Tahfiẓ Umar Bin Al- Khattab was said to be (1) motivating; (2) coordination; (3) leadership and (4) maintaining good relations with ustadh, santri and staff. Fourth, controlling in Ma'had Tahfiẓ Umar Bin Al-Khattab is divided into (1) monitoring and evaluation (2) assessment. Fifth, the constraints of management of Islamic education institutions in the Islamic program in Ma'ad Umar Bin Al-Khattab consist of, (1) financial activities and operations in Ma'had Tahfiad Umar Bin Al-Khattab Surabaya still rely on permanent donors; (2) makeshift facilities; (3) Inadequate human resources. The six obstacles faced in the tahfiẓ al-Qur'an program are (1) the saturation and laziness felt by the santri in carrying out established programs; (2)  guarding  the memorization  of  the  Qur'an  that  has  been  memorized  (3) guarding themselves from immorality. From the results of this study it can be suggested (1) in improving the quality of Islamic education institutions, Ma'had Tahfiẓ Umar Bin Al-Khattab Surabaya should improve the quality of institutional management; (2) The Asia Muslim Charity Foundation (AMCF) should provide funds for operational and learning activities that exist in Ma’had Tahfiẓ Umar Bin Al-Khattab Surabaya; (3) The Asia Muslim Charity Foundation (AMCF) and the Muhammadiyah Union pay more attention to existing facilities in Ma’had Tahfiẓ Umar Bin Al-Khattab Surabaya. (4) the results of this study can be used as reference material in developing and implementing management of educational institutions, especially in Islamic education institutions that implement the tahfiẓ al-Qur'an program; (5) the need for development research on the comparison of management of Islamic education institutions in the tahfiẓ al-Qur'an program, especially the management of educational institutions in Ma’had Tahfiẓ Umar Bin Al-Khattab Surabaya.

Arabic has been chosen as a medium of the revealed language for every language speakers in the world. Arabic is a language which rich in vocabulary and also as an intact language which has the system and style of language to overcome other languages. This language is the language of science, civilization, and intellectuality from the past until now and later. No wonder, Allah SWT has placed it on the highest maqqom (position) as the Qur'anic language. The Qur'an is something that must be understood and appreciated, or even made as second language by the unique Indonesian society (it is the largest moslem population but its national language is latin) especially by educated generations of Islamic educational institutions. The classic problem faced by moslems in Idonesia is the lack of understanding and appreciating of Islamic values ​​due to the weakening of arabic. It is interesting to be learned and deepened as the reflection and improvement of religious behavior of society and specialized for Islamic Educational Institutions that create moslem generation. This article will discuss the role of Islamic Education Institutions in Indonesia in Arabic learning process and also approaches used Arabic language acquisition until placed it become second language.

Abstract This article discusses the dynamics of contemporary Islamic education. The goal of Islamic education is to provide human resources based on Islamic values and in accordance with the spirit of Islam. The methods of education and instruction should also be designed to achieve the goal. Any methodology that is not oriented towards achieving the goal will certainly be avoided. Thus, Islamic education is not merely transfer of knowledge, but whether the science given can change attitudes. Within this framework, intensive monitoring should be done by society, including government (state), towards learners' behaviors. The next step is realizing it so that necessary education and curriculum programs are harmonious and sustainable. Islamic higher education institutions should be self-evident and transform themselves to meet the challenges of increasingly competitive and complex era. Islamic universities are considered not marketable anymore in facing global competition. Contemporary education must adjust with the recent technological developments. The purpose of this study is to formulate the efforts that can be done to develop the quality of Islamic Education in Indonesia. The type of research is descriptive qualitative. The data used in this study are qualitative data that are collected using literature study method and processed using qualitative analysis techniques. The study findings suggest that efforts to develop the quality of Islamic Education in Indonesia include: 1) Integrating products from the development and advancement of science and technology into the Islamic Education system; 2) Applying a comprehensive approach and learning method that combines Islamic education provided at school, in the family, and in society, balanced by communicative delivery and exemplary practice of Islamic values; 3) Implementation of quality management of Islamic Education covering the management of educational institutions and all components of education in it, including teachers, learners, educational facilities, learning process, and community relations; 4) Increasing the welfare of teachers to encourage the improvement of the work ethos, which in turn will be able to contribute maximally in improving the quality of Islamic Education; and 5) Directing learning practices in Islamic Education on the purpose of increasing understanding, mastery, and application of Islamic values by learners.
